PA Lottery ticket worth over $140,000 sold in Dauphin County

LOWER SWATARA TOWNSHIP, Pa. (WHTM) — A Pennsylvania Lottery ticket worth more than $141,800 has been sold in Dauphin County.

According to the PA Lottery, the winning ticket for the Suite Winnings game was sold at a lottery retailer on Wednesday, March 18. As a result of the winning ticket sale, the CVS on 1565 West Harrisburg Pike in Lower Swatara Township will receive a $500 bonus.
